Will You Need an X-ray?

Most patients do not need an x-ray. Sometimes, a chiropractor will order an x-ray based on your condition. While chiropractors an tell what is going on with a patient’s musculoskeletal system through a physical examination, there are some conditions that x-rays can help a physician diagnose. An x-ray provides doctors with a deeper understanding of your system so that they can help figure out the best treatment possible.

Will You Receive Treatment Right Away?

In most cases, your chiropractor will treat you on your first visit. There may be exceptions to more complex cases, but in general, you will undergo an adjustment after your initial examination. The initial examination will include an interview and then the physician will conduct a physical exam. When finished, you are likely to undergo a chiropractic adjustment.
